The Gut and Skin: A Deeply Connected Relationship


Your gut and skin connect in ways you may not understand. Both are intricate systems that engage with your immune, endocrine, and nerves, playing a vital duty in general health and wellness. The gut microbiome-- made up of trillions of germs-- assists regulate digestion, nutrient absorption, and immune action. When it's in consistency, your body successfully gets rid of toxins and takes in the vitamins and minerals essential for a vibrant complexion.


However, when gut health is compromised, problems develop. Poor food digestion, swelling, and microbial imbalances can trigger skin issues such as acne, rosacea, dermatitis, and early aging. The gut-skin axis is a vital link that discloses just how inner health and wellness is reviewed the outside.

Exactly How Diet Impacts the Gut-Skin Connection


What you eat plays an essential function in both gut and skin health. Processed foods, sugar, and artificial additives can interfere with the gut microbiome, leading to systemic inflammation and skin flare-ups. On the check out here other hand, a nutrient-dense diet plan loaded with whole foods sustains both digestion and skincare advantages. Prioritizing gut-friendly foods can have an extensive influence on your skin's clearness and vigor.


Fermented foods such as yogurt, kimchi, and sauerkraut present helpful probiotics that sustain gut bacteria. Fiber-rich vegetables and fruits assist maintain healthy and balanced food digestion, while omega-3 fatty acids from resources like salmon and flaxseeds lower swelling. Consuming alcohol a lot of water and cutting down on excess sugar can likewise keep your gut microbiome in check, allowing your skin to normally radiance.


Stress and anxiety, Sleep, and Their Role in Skin Health


Stress and anxiety and inadequate sleep do not just impact your state of mind-- they also damage your gut and skin. Persistent stress triggers hormonal discrepancies that disrupt digestion, causing inflammation and an overgrowth of hazardous germs in the gut. This can show up as boosted outbreaks, level of sensitivity, and premature aging. Poor sleep additional compounds the trouble by decreasing your body's ability to fix and regenerate skin cells over night.


Incorporating stress-reducing activities such as meditation, deep breathing, and gentle workout can dramatically profit both gut and skin health. Prioritizing quality sleep guarantees your body has the time it requires to recover, bring about a clearer and more balanced complexion.
